Kirjoittaja Aihe: Päivittäinen ajastettu shutdown (Ubuntu Server)?  (Luettu 3431 kertaa)

heinäkenkä

  • Käyttäjä
  • Viestejä: 75
    • Profiili
Moi,

Olen aivan käsi näissä komentojutuissa, joten tarvitsisin neuvot miten Ubuntu Serverin saisi sammumaan päivittäin tiettyyn kellon aikaan ( vaikka nyt 2300).
Käytössä on Webmin tai tietty komentorivi.

H.

juyli

  • Vieras
Vs: Päivittäinen ajastettu shutdown (Ubuntu Server)?
« Vastaus #1 : 01.06.09 - klo:12.01 »
tarvitsisin neuvot miten Ubuntu Serverin saisi sammumaan päivittäin tiettyyn kellon aikaan ( vaikka nyt 2300).

Ajastuksiin voidaan käyttää Cron:ia/Anacron:ia (tai at -komentoa).
Koneen sammuttaminen taas jo onnistuu suoraa komennolla shutdown.
man 8 shutdown
http://www.manpagez.com/man/8/shutdown/
SYNOPSIS
     shutdown [-] [-h [-u] | -r | -s | -k] [-o [-n]] time
              [warning-message ...]
...
-h      The system is halted at the specified time.
...


heinäkenkä

  • Käyttäjä
  • Viestejä: 75
    • Profiili
Vs: Päivittäinen ajastettu shutdown (Ubuntu Server)?
« Vastaus #2 : 01.06.09 - klo:12.29 »
Ok,

Eli komento olisi siis:

shutdown -h 2300

Mihinkäs se pitäisi tallentaa, että homma tapahtuisi päivittäin?

H.

juyli

  • Vieras
Vs: Päivittäinen ajastettu shutdown (Ubuntu Server)?
« Vastaus #3 : 01.06.09 - klo:17.06 »
Mihinkäs se pitäisi tallentaa, että homma tapahtuisi päivittäin?
Yksi vaihtoehto olisi /etc/rc.local (tai /etc/init.d/rc.local tai /etc/rc.d jakelusta riippuen). Tuo rc.local tiedosto on tarkoitettu nimenomaan omien skriptien/komentojen ajamiseksi koneen käynnistyksen yhteydessä.
Tietysti voit tehdä siitä myös oman init-tason rc -scriptitiedoston, joka ajetaan koneen käynnistyessä. 

Kullervo

  • Käyttäjä
  • Viestejä: 876
    • Profiili
Vs: Päivittäinen ajastettu shutdown (Ubuntu Server)?
« Vastaus #4 : 01.06.09 - klo:17.36 »
Minä olen joskus tehnyt näin:
Koodia: [Valitse]
sudo nano /etc/crontab
Ja sinne rivi
Koodia: [Valitse]
00 21   * * *   root    shutdown -h now
tuo sammuttaa koneen klo  21.00